Description
The Buzuluk sunflower variety belongs to the oil-type category and is characterized by high stability in productivity under various soil and climatic conditions. It is a very early-maturing variety with a vegetation period of about 102 days, and it is characterized by its dwarf stature, reaching plant heights from 145 to 165 cm. The disk diameter varies from 16 to 21 cm, while the mass of 1000 seeds is about 62 grams. The oil content in the seeds ranges from 42% to 53.7%, making the variety high-oil and attractive for producing linoleum-type oil.
The Buzuluk variety has high resistance to major sunflower diseases, including downy mildew, phoma, fusarium, and dry rot. It is also resistant to dodder, which significantly reduces the risk of yield losses. Thanks to its increased drought resistance and adaptability, the variety is recommended for cultivation in all natural-climatic zones suitable for growing sunflowers, including the Central-Black-Earth, North-Caucasian, Ural, and West-Siberian regions.
To achieve maximum yield, which can reach 35 c/ha, the Buzuluk variety requires high-quality soil treatment and fertilization. The recommended plant density before harvest is 55-60 thousand per hectare in areas with insufficient moisture and 60-65 thousand per hectare in areas with sufficient moisture.
